Shelter Installation in Conroe, TX
Shelter installation services encompass the setup of structures designed to provide protection and shade for outdoor areas. This includes a variety of projects such as carports, patio covers, awnings, pergolas, and other covered outdoor spaces. Property owners typically seek these services to enhance outdoor comfort, improve property value, or create functional areas for gatherings and daily activities. Before requesting shelter installation, homeowners should consider the size and design of the structure, the materials that best suit their needs, and any local building codes or permits that may be required.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ential when planning shelter installation. Property owners often want to know about the durability of different materials, the compatibility of the structure with existing property features, and the potential impact on property aesthetics. Clarifying these aspects helps ensure the chosen shelter meets both functional needs and personal preferences, making it easier to select the right design and materials for the space.

Shelter Installation Questions
What types of shelters can be installed? Various structures such as carports, pergolas, and storage sheds can be installed to suit different needs and property styles.
What materials are commonly used for shelter installation? Common materials include wood, metal, and vinyl, chosen for durability and appearance.
Is a foundation necessary for shelter installation? Yes, a stable foundation ensures proper support and longevity of the shelter structure.
What should property owners consider before installation? Factors like location, purpose, and existing landscape help determine the best type and placement of the shelter.
